IMHO China managed to contain the virus internally by its strong arm tactics as early as February 2020. All movement was restricted and controlled at various levels where testing and certification happened such that for one to reach the international airport it was almost certain he or she was virus free. Towards end of February the spread had peaked and started to decline sharply. However the epicenter was fast moving to Italia....but we kept on looking at the total number of infections and not the rate of increase of new cases hence missed the critical hint as exemplified by the complaints about China Southern Airlines. If we thought the disease could only arrive from China persons from China were already arriving anyway through Ethiopian and middle east carriers.
As @ Masukuma says the data was not utilized to inform decision. NB WHO started publishing the daily surveillance data in January 2020. Today in the spirit of supporting SMEs they have banned mitumba again against scientific data on virus survival and propagation.

I saw this and I was facepalming (before I realised I was not supposed to touch my face!!)
Come on guys... I have beef with Mitumba for other reasons but let's not act in Hysteria!! Let's assume someone died today of Corona.. how long will it take for them to pack and sell , then ship the clothes? then get them here to Gikomba, unpack and sell, then you wear it (assume without washing) - that will be what 2-3 months? this virus survives longest what - couple of days outside the body on metal surfaces. less than a week!! it's hysteria!!
